Wedding Guest Dress Etiquette: Decoding The Invite
Wedding guest dress etiquette starts with reading the invitation carefully, as the dress code dictates everything from hemline to fabric choice. For black-tie events, a floor-length gown or a dressy long sleeve maxi is expected, while cocktail attire calls for a chic mini or midi length (brides.com). Semi-formal and garden party dress codes offer more flexibility, allowing for lighter fabrics like linen and floral prints.
A common mistake is treating all evening weddings as black-tie. If the invitation specifies semi-formal, a long sleeve mini dress in satin or crepe strikes the right balance between polished and relaxed. When in doubt, err on the side of sophistication: a tailored long sleeve dress reads as more formal than a strapless sundress, and it is easier to dress a look down with accessories than to dress it up at the last minute.
How To Style Long Sleeve Dresses For A Wedding
Styling a long sleeve dress for a wedding comes down to balancing proportions and choosing accessories that complement, rather than compete with, the sleeves. With statement sleeves like puff or feather details, keep jewellery minimal: a pair of stud earrings and a delicate bracelet are enough. For sleek, fitted long sleeves, you can afford a bolder earring or a clutch with metallic embellishment.
Shoe pairing depends on the hemline. Mini dresses pair beautifully with heeled sandals or pointed-toe pumps, while maxi and midi lengths call for strappy heels that elongate the leg. A midi length dress works well with block heels for outdoor ceremonies, preventing your heels from sinking into grass (theknot.com). Consider the venue, the season, and the dress code when choosing your footwear, and always bring a backup pair of flats for the dance floor.

Fabric Care And Travel Tips For Your Hired Dress
Caring for a hired designer dress ensures it arrives back in perfect condition and that you look flawless throughout the event. Before your wedding day, steam the dress gently to release any creases from transit, but avoid direct contact between the steamer head and delicate fabrics like silk or feather trims. For embellished styles, turn the dress inside out when steaming to protect crystals and sequins.
When travelling to a destination wedding, pack the dress in a garment bag and hang it in the car or plane cabin if possible. For crepe and silk styles, a handheld steamer is your best friend, while lace and tulle may only need a light misting of water to refresh. Always check the care label before attempting any stain removal, and for stubborn marks, consult a professional dry cleaner who has experience with luxury fabrics.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are long sleeve dresses appropriate for summer weddings?
Yes, when you choose the right fabric. Lightweight options like silk, linen and crepe keep you cool even in warmer weather. Many of the dresses in our hire range, such as the Hansen & Gretel Sundra Slip in silk, are designed for breathability. A long sleeve dress also offers coverage from the sun during an outdoor ceremony, making it a practical and elegant choice for Australian summer weddings.
How do I style a long sleeve dress for a formal wedding?
Focus on accessories that complement the sleeve style. With a puff or embellished sleeve, keep jewellery minimal and opt for a sleek updo to show off the detail. For a sleek satin slip, add statement earrings and a clutch. Finish with heeled sandals or pumps, and consider a tailored blazer for the ceremony if the dress code leans toward black tie.
Can I wear a sleeved dress to a black-tie wedding?
Absolutely. Sleeved dresses are a sophisticated choice for black-tie events. Look for floor-length styles in luxe fabrics like satin or silk, or mini dresses with embellished sleeves for a modern take. The key is the fabric and tailoring. A well-fitted long sleeve maxi dress reads as formal and elegant, offering coverage without sacrificing style.
